What type of FMR does Sullivan County use?

Small Area Fair Market Rents were created by the HUD for this county/Metro Fmr Area however Sullivan County is not required to use Small Area FMRs by the HUD. It is at the discretion of the local Housing Authority to determine if SAFMRs or 40th percentile FMRs are used.

How does Sullivan County compare?

Sullivan County ($1,078) has a 22.9% lower FMR for 2-Bedroom housing than the average of New York ($1,398) and therefore has a lower gross rent.

Sullivan County is rank 35th out of 62 counties. This means the FMRs, or in other words, the gross rent is lower than 34 other counties. Sullivan County is the 28th cheapest county in terms of FMRs.

The 90% and 110% SAFMRs represent the minimum and maximum payment standards that can be set by the local Public Housing Authority under regular conditions. The payment standard is the actual value used in Section 8. For more on payment standards click here.

FMRs and SAFMRs are set by the HUD. The local PHA takes these FMR/SAFMR values and may decide to use any value that is within +-10% of the FMR/SAFMR as the payment standard for the areas under their jurisdiction.
